Republic of Macedonia to create online gambling monopoly

The government of the Republic of Macedonia has decided to move to a monopoly model in the online gambling industry. The company that will have the sole online gambling license in the country arises as a fruit of a partnership between the local government and the Casinos Austriacompany, the government owning 51% of the new company.

Spain's gambling authority supports lower taxes

The Spanish government enforces a 25% tax on online gambling operators' gross revenue. According to the operators and other companies that want to break into the Spanish market, the 25% tax is too high.

Sheldon Adelson's Internet Gambling Control Act

The north-american billionaire, owner to one of the largest fortunes in the world and CEO of the Las Vegas Sands group, keeps on fighting online gambling ardently. Sheldon Adelson, who has already stated he's willing to "spend as much as necessary", has drafted a bill that intends to ban online gambling in each state of the United States of America.
